WildGaussians: Revolutionizing Real-time 3D Rendering of Uncontrolled Environments

WildGaussians is a groundbreaking AI tool designed to generate real-time 3D renderings of complex, uncontrolled environments. Unlike traditional rendering techniques that struggle with the variability and occlusion challenges inherent in natural settings, WildGaussians leverages advanced AI algorithms to achieve ultra-efficient management of these complexities, resulting in highly realistic and dynamic 3D visualizations. This article explores its capabilities, applications, and competitive landscape.

What WildGaussians Does

WildGaussians excels at creating photorealistic 3D models of scenes that would be incredibly difficult or time-consuming to model using traditional methods. It tackles the challenges of:

  • Occlusion: Efficiently handles the blocking of one object by another, a major computational hurdle in real-time rendering of complex scenes with numerous objects.
  • Appearance Variations: Accurately represents the variability in appearance of objects due to factors like lighting, shadows, and material properties, leading to more natural-looking 3D models.
  • Real-time Rendering: Provides immediate feedback, crucial for interactive applications and iterative design processes.
